Juventus vs Barcelona as it happened: Paulo Dybala and Giorgio Chiellini put Italian champions in control of tie

Paulo Dybala scored two superb first-half goals as Juventus took complete control of their Champions League quarter-final against Barcelona.

It took Dybala just seven minutes to open the scoring, curling home a low shot from the edge of the six-yard box.

He then doubled the Italian champion's advantage when he struck again, angling a first-time shot beyond Marc-André ter Stegen from outside the penalty area.

Barcelona pushed in search of an away goal but conceded again in the second-half, as Giorgio Chiellini climbed above Javier Mascherano at a corner to head home.

1 min: Juventus with the early pressure and Khedira has an early attempt, which fizzes wide.

3 mins: A good early chance for Juventus, as Iniesta cynically trips up Dybala as he's about to burst through on goal. 

Pjanic swings the ball in where Higuain is lurking unmarked in the box! It's a fine opportunity but the striker heads the ball directly into the midriff of Ter Stegen, who smothers it at the second time of asking.

9 mins: It really was a sumptuous finish. Cuadrado wriggled past his man with the ball and offloaded it to Dybala, who was lurking on the edge of the six-yard box with Barcelona's defence dropped deep. 

The Argentine didn't even bother to look up upon receiving the ball: instead immediately curling it around Ter Stegen with his left-foot and into the top corner of the goal. A fine finish, albeit made possible by some really poor defending.

11 mins: Messi isn't happy. He collects the ball on the edge of the area and looks to drift past Chiellini, but the Italian defender steps across him and hauls him down.

Messi to take the free-kick right on the very edge of the area, but he whips his side-foot shot well over the bar.

14 mins: Juventus have dropped off in intensity since the goal, giving Barcelona the opportunity to throw some bodies forward in search of an early equaliser. 

Pique, Umtiti and Mathieu all take turns to shuffle the ball back and forth, before Iniesta bursts forward and looks to spring a team-mate into some space. He finds Neymar, who chips the ball into Suarez ... but his flick in the direction of Roberto is far too heavy and the ball goes out for a throw.
